The arc length is given by the formula ...
s = rθ
where r represents the radius, and θ represents the central angle in radians.
The angle of 60° is π/3 radians, so the arc length is ...
s = 15(π/3) = 5π ≈ 15.71 . . . units
LN ≈ 15.71 units
